The Details

  • Pay: £14.30 per hour
  • Hours: 40 hours per week
  • Working Pattern: Monday to Friday with Saturdays on a rota basis [07.30 – 16.00]
  • Location: Clifton College, 32 College Road, Clifton, Bristol BS8 3JH
  • Must hold a full UK current MANUAL driving license for a minimum of two years with no endorsements.

Why Join Us?

At Sodexo, we value you for who you are. As a Delivery and Stores Supervisor, you’ll play a key role in making sure deliveries across the college campus (including sports ground BB) of food supplies, light equipment, hospitality equipment and other catering employees runs smoothly.

What You’ll Do

  • Ensure customers’ orders are delivered, product quantities accounted for and documentation completed
  • To carry out daily vehicle checks and report any defects
  • To adhere to daily delivery schedule and meet customers time slots
  • To drive a company / client vehicle (transit size van) and comply with Sodexo’s / Clients driving policy and regulations
  • To make deliveries across the college campus (including sports ground BB) of food supplies, light equipment, hospitality equipment and other catering employees
  • Promote a friendly working relationship with colleagues and client staff
  • Promote a good company image to customers and guests by using positive customer service practices
  • To liaise with Store Manager, hospitality team, Executive Head Chef and Catering Manager
  • To accept deliveries of stock ensuring they are correct and any damage or discrepancies are recorded
  • To ensure that any orders are suitably packaged ready for delivery and keep accurate records of where stock is allocated around site
  • To ensure the safety and security of the stock and complete frequent and accurate stock takes
  • To report any complaints and take action where possible
  • Assisting with loading and unloading items from vehicles
  • To be able to effectively use the computer including answering emails, word processing and spreadsheets
  • Maintain HACCP records in the stores area and have good understanding and practice of manual handling
  • To deputise in the absence of the Store manager
  • To undertake occasional duties outside the normal routine but within the scope of the position and the departments activities

What You Bring

  • Must hold a full UK current Manual driving license for a minimum of two years with no endorsements.
  • Experience in similar role either in a stores/ warehouse capacity or kitchen/catering environment.
  • Good time management and organizational skills
  • Self-motivated and pro-active
  • Ability to work in a role that requires physical effort and perform manual handling tasks
  • Ability to work as part of a team or individually as needed
  • Ability to work well under pressure
  • Positive approach to learning in role and identifying own training needs as appropriate
  • Numerate and Literate
